为什么CPU需要时钟为什么CPU需要时钟这样一个概念?什么是时钟脉冲,CPU为什么需要时钟时钟信号是怎么产生的?上面这个图的方波就是一个脉冲,类比于人类的脉搏跳动。一个脉冲称之为CPU的一个时钟信号,或者时钟脉冲。一个脉冲周期就叫CPU时钟周期,一个时钟周期内时钟信号震荡一次。接下来我们先来看这个电路图:在上图中,起初时,.当输入信号发生变化时,逻辑元件不会立即对输入变化做出反应,会有一个传播时
什么是时钟脉冲,CPU为什么需要时钟时钟信号是怎么产生的?首先知道什么是脉冲 上图的一个方波称为一个脉冲,类似于人类的脉搏跳动。对于每一个方形脉冲,电压或电路从0上升到最大值的那条线叫做上升沿;反之,电压或电流逐渐下降的那条线叫做下降沿。一个脉冲称为CPU的一个时钟信号,或者时钟脉冲。一个脉冲周期就叫CPU时钟周期,一个时钟周期内时钟信号震荡一次。脉冲的单位两个脉冲相继出现的间隔时间,就是脉冲
常看到说,时钟信号是用来“同步”系统各器件(CPU、内存、总线等)的工作的。但是这里的“同步”实在是太笼统了。什么是“同步”?各器件为什么要同步? 以下内容为个个学习总结出来的观点,不保证其正确性 下面举存储器的例子来说明。 先要了解到“存储器”是用触发器(flip-flop)或电容器(capacitor)做的。用触发器的就是SRAM,用电容器的就是DRAM。因为电容是会不断放电的,所以要不断对其
单片机里时序单位经常会混淆不清,原因是教材不同,叫法不一,本文通俗理清他们之间的关系 古老的教材里是这样说的:  ” MCS-51的每个机器周期包含6个状态周期,每个状态周期划分为2个节拍,分别对应着2个节拍时钟有效期间。因此一个机器周期包含12个振荡周期,由S1P1(状态1节拍1)一直到S6P2(状态6拍2),每个节拍持续一个震荡周期,每个状态周期持续
CPU为什么需要时钟脉冲,类似于人类的心跳。对于一个方形脉冲脉冲幅值从0上升到最大值的过程叫做上升沿;反之,叫做下降沿。一个脉冲称为CPU的一个时钟信号,或者时钟脉冲。一个脉冲周期就叫CPU时钟周期。从对时钟的需求角度分类,CPU分为需要时钟:同步CPU (synchronous CPU),和不使用时钟工作的异步CPU (asynchronous CPU)。由于异步CPU设计复杂成本高昂,目前广
快速边沿脉冲发生器是一种能够产生高频率、快速上升或下降边沿的电路或设备。它通常用于测试和测量领域,特别是在数字电路和通信系统中。快速边沿脉冲发生器的工作原理通常基于电容放电或者开关切换的原理。其中,电容放电方式是通过充电电容器并在需要的时候通过放电来产生脉冲。而开关切换方式则是通过开关的切换来控制电路的导通和断开,从而产生脉冲。快速边沿脉冲发生器的特点包括: 1. 高频率:能够产生高频率的脉冲信号
1、做板子的时候太粗心了,经验不足是个问题,当时是先想画好板子然后再对照买元件。后来想想应该先把元件买回来,好对比下封装,可以自己画或者找对的。(有必要还是画下封装好,个人认为,有时候找反而更浪费时间)2、有源晶振的接法搞错了,应该是 1NC 2GND 3OUT 4VDD3、用cp2102不方便焊接,卖元件的美女建议我用ft232和2303,先mark一个,不过已经买了,练习练习下怎么焊吧,以后改
原创 2021-08-20 14:18:14
473阅读
控制(单脉冲)的跨时钟域传输问题存在两种情况,一种是从快时钟域到慢钟域...
原创 2022-04-18 17:05:10
503阅读
正常时间显示 <SCRIPT language=javascript> <!-- function Year_Month(){ var now = new Date(); var yy = now.getYear(); var mm = now.getMonth(); var mmm=new Array(); mmm[0]="J
转载 3月前
60阅读
时钟脉冲信号按一定的电压幅度,一定的时间间隔连续发出的脉冲信号叫做时钟脉冲信号。用于给处理器和其他硬件提供时钟度量。 时钟脉冲频率在单位时间内产生的时钟脉冲的个数叫做时间脉冲频率 时钟源分类1.晶振:又称晶体振荡器,通过石英晶体切割、加电极、通电后会产生固定的机械震荡。优点是结构简单、噪声低,缺点是生产成本高。2.PLL:锁相环,通过外部晶振和锁相环电路来提高晶振的频率。&nb
指令格式之操作码地址码一、指令格式操作码字段 地址码字段操作码字段:表征指令的操作特性与功能 (指令的唯一标识) 不同的指令操作码不能相同 地址码字段:指定参与操作的操作数的地址码二、操作码分类操作码可以分为固定长度的代码和可变长度的代码1、固定长度的代码所有指令操作码的长度相等 例如:某计算机共有64条指令,采用固定长度操作码,需要6位编码,从000000~111111 2的6次方
脉冲型滤波器用成型脉冲即数字1用矩形脉冲表示用升余弦脉冲或高斯脉冲表示主要用于基带数据处理。  在数字通信系统中,基带信号进入调制器前,波形是矩形脉冲,突变的上升沿和下降沿包含高频成分较丰富,信号的频谱一般比较宽。从本质上说,脉冲成形就是一种滤波。数字通信系统的信号都必须在一定的频带内,但是基带脉冲信号的频谱是一个Sa函数,在频带上是无限宽的,单个符号的脉冲将会延伸到相邻符号码元内产生码间串扰,这
## Python脉冲信号 ### 什么是脉冲信号脉冲信号是一种特殊类型的信号,它在一个短时间内突然变化,然后迅速恢复到原始状态。脉冲信号通常由一个短暂的电压脉冲或电流脉冲组成,可以用来表示信息传递、控制系统和数学模型等方面。 ### Python中的脉冲信号 在Python中,我们可以使用多种方式生成和处理脉冲信号。下面我们将介绍几种常用的方法: #### 1. 使用time模块生
原创 9月前
203阅读
我们都知道PLC是通过输入端口和输出端口与外部元器件和设备进行连接的。输入端口主要接收的是各种元器件向PLC提供的开关量信号、数据量信号。而输出端口主要是向外部发出开关量信号、数据量信号脉冲信号去控制外部负载的。今天的分享让我们先看一下PLC的输入端口连接的元器件吧。对于输入端口连接的元器件,分为无源开关、有源开关和脉冲信号元器件。我们要了解一下无源开关、有源开关的特点是什么,而什么是脉冲信号
如图为M415步进电机驱动器Signal端 PUL为脉冲输入信号。 DIR方向输入信号,用于改变电机运转方向;不接该口会朝一个默认方向转动 ENA为使能信号,用于使能或禁止驱动器输出; OPTO为脉冲、方向、使能信号电源正端,接5v。High Voltage端 A+和A-接步进电机A相绕组的正负端;B+和B-接步进电机B相绕组的正负端。 步进电机一般有两组共四条线引出,取两条线相连,若用手转电机
描述脉冲信号脉冲信号是一种离散信号,形状多种多样,与普通模拟信号(如正弦波)相比,波形之间在时间轴不连续(波形与波形之间有明显的间隔)但具有一定的周期性是它的特点。最常见的脉冲波是矩形波(也就是方波)。脉冲信号可以用来表示信息,也可以用来作为载波,比如脉冲调制中的脉冲编码调制(PCM),脉冲宽度调制(PWM)等等,还可以作为各种数字电路、高性能芯片的时钟信号脉冲信号怎么产生脉冲信号一般都是利用自
一、应用场景通常而言一个大型的SOC系统是有很多的模块组成的,那么从外部模块发送过来的请求信号i_req(假设这个请求信号脉冲信号)可以直接用于自己编写的模块作为sram的读使能信号ram_rden么?为了保险起见,是不建议作为别的模块的使能信号。二、竞争与冒险2.1 竞争与冒险的定义信号由于经由不同路径传输达到某一汇合点的时间有先有后的现象,就称之为竞争;由于竞争现象所引起的电路输出发生瞬间错
脉冲宽度是个很广泛的词,在不同的领域,脉冲宽度有不同的含义。脉冲宽度从学术角度讲就是电流或者电压随时间有规律变化的时间宽度,平时研究主要是方波,三角波,锯齿波,正弦函数波等等,这些波形变化都是有一定规律的,方波里面一般不说脉冲宽度,而是说占空比,即在一段连续工作时间内脉冲占用的时间与总时间的比值。光学领域脉冲光源的闪光持续时间是指1/3峰值,光强所对应的时间间隔称为脉冲宽度。它主要由光源的结构和点
用51单片机设计一个四通道脉冲发生器,要求每个方波频率、占空比、振幅可单独调节。 这里采用的方法是用定时器产生一个基础方波,在基础方波的基础上叠加方波上升沿下降沿从而实现频率可调。 不足之处:因为采用的是51单片机,方波的频率不会特别高。代码如下:#include "reg52.h" #include "absacc.h" #include "stdio.h" #include "math.h
  • 1
  • 2
  • 3
  • 4
  • 5